The VEVOR Large Metal Chicken Coop with Run is a robust, walk-in poultry enclosure measuring 13.1 x 9.8 x 6.6 ft, constructed from 1" galvanized steel pipes and hexagonal wire mesh for superior strength and predator defense. Featuring a waterproof, sun-protective PE tarp with a dome roof design, it offers excellent weather resistance. This versatile coop accommodates chickens, ducks, rabbits, and other small animals, combining spacious comfort with easy assembly for a secure, stylish outdoor habitat.

Great Chicken Coop
Decent buy for the money, perfect for chickens which is what i used it for. I wanted one that the whole top was covered bit this one only covered half. So I got a 12x16 tarp that covered the whole top and used the one they set to cover the back. Pretty simple to assemble. The wire takes a bit to work out but works good, even had some left over. The zip ties were short by half, but maybe I used too many. Most of it snaps together and they send a cheap wrench to take care of the few bolts it uses. I used 200 more zip ties and used a pair of wire cutters and that as it. It is light weight, but for chickens it works great!!

Very large, but only has 1 entrance which is annoying
This thing is MASSIVE and works great for my ducks. Takes some time to put together (about 4 hours), but once assembled it holds up extremely well. Its big enough that I built a little duck-shanty inside and added a pond yet still has plenty of space to move around. The only thing that would make it function better would be if it had a door/gate on each end. It has kept out raccoons, foxes, opposum, owls and even coyotes. The instructions are easy to read, but the boxes it came in were VERY heavy so be prepaired to spend some time and muscle putting it together. It came with extra parts so there was nothing missing and the wire around it bends SUPER EASY. I highly recommend this run for all poultry birds.

Large, heavy duty chicken run
This is a very good product. The metal bars are fence grade quality and weight and the netting is okay. It was used tl introduce new chicjens to an existing flock. Once that was done, we refurbished it and it now works great as an add-on to extend an existing run, giving the chickens extra room to run in when they need space from each other. We have had it a while and don't see any rust. It was fairly easy to put together but you do need to wire the netting together. I wired it after I put it on the frame. It is heavy to move. I just put a tarp under the one side (so it slid better) and lifted up the other side to cart different places. It was missing one bolt but it was such a common sized bolt, rather than wait, I just got a bolt from the supply store so I can't tell you how quickly they would take care of that. The door goes together well but if the frame is not true, the door does not close well. It is easy to fix though.

Good starter for birds but requires added materials
Good for a temporary set up. I got the 10x6ft and i will be adding more reinforcements to make it more sturdy and safe. The netting it comes w is very thin wire and easy to break. I will be replacing it w better wire. Its frame is easy to put together but did take longer then expected. The frame and tarp are great but i do recommend getting a different netting w thicker wire to better protect your birds. Definitely wont hold back dogs. It is very light so get better ground stakes as well so it doesnt blow away in extreme winds. Otherwise happy w it for now, prior to added materials, and so are my birds.

Overall Good Purchase
Bought it on sale for $135, using it as a catio. The frame is very easy to put together. You will need a power drill for one kind of screw, and a socket wrench will also help you on some other pieces. The chicken wire is annoying but I think that's just the nature of chicken wire. I had extra left over. You will likely need about 200-300 more zip ties (it comes with 100). I ended up using some sturdy plant stakes to help give extra support where the ends of wire sections met. It's a little higher off the ground than I would like, which is probably fine for chickens, but not for cats. I put wood boards around the outside. The tarp seems fine, it hasn't gone through any bad weather yet though. It only covers the top I will probably get another tarp for one of the sides and part of the back. I wish it had another door lock thing. with just one, it's easy for a cat to push against it and slip out of the bottom corner. Going to keep a block of wood and a cinder block there. Overall, good for the price, especially if it's on sale.
